About This Pipe
Mark Tinsky has quite the storied history in American pipe making, founding the American Smoking Pipe Co. in 1978 and maintaining a consistent output for the over four decades that have elapsed since then. Tinsky lives in Montana and spends his days fly fishing and making pipes, bringing his many years of experience in the craft to every shape he fashions. He boasts a rather diverse portfolio, offering a wide range of shapes in a variety of unique finishes. Tinsky is also well known for his accenting work, incorporating everything from hardwoods to metals into his compositions. A fine showcase of Tinsky's style, this bent Apple sees a plump, full-bodied bowl posed at the fore of a balanced shank and a demurely curved tapered stem. It's dressed in a crisp tanblast that highlights rippling grain across the stummel.
